Transaction 39551434c15483ca9dcfa51e45d3a24f7b6bed4b83f8301052a40769fe6cfb6b
1 Input
1 Output
-
39551434c15483ca9dcfa51e45d3a24f7b6bed4b83f8301052a40769fe6cfb6b:0
- value
- 2046509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4185593954bc27254c2fa23ffaf0032fcbbca7ea OP_EQUAL
- address
- 37fTbEMfo3G83uzJxEZ6fPm1YKb2Bkxy3Z